THEFT OF A MOTOR-CAR.

OFFENCE IN WELLINGTON.

TRAVELLER'S SAMPLES TAKE}?-

Information was received by the Anck< land police yesterday that a motor-carj the property of Sargood, Son, and Even, Ltd., had been stolen in Wellington th<* previous evening. The car is a five-seateS Dodge, with a Wellington number-plate, 6896. It was valued at £485, and cot* tained traveller's samples of millinery"} hosiery, and ladies' hats, valued at £15. .
